Candy, drink, tobacco and even books you have been pulled out of a vending machine. In the U.S. Internet retailer Amazon is experimenting with selling ereaders, tablets and accessories through a vending machine. The market leader of online sales explores in this way forms of offline sales.

Stores like Barnes & Noble have something for online sales: their presence on the streets and the convenience to have after purchasing a product immediately in your possession. Amazon have been going on longer rumors that the company would like to open physical stores, just like the Apple Stores. But perhaps a machine called a much better idea.

At the airport of Las Vegas has recently become an automaton from Amazon. Ideal for travelers who just like to have. Whatever reading material just before their departure They find in the vending various products, such as the basic model of the Kindle (69 dollars), the Kindle Paperwhite (119 dollars), several tablets, and related accessories. Virtually everything in the Kindle series is in the machine, the Kindle Fire HDX ($ 379) to a $ 20 adapter.

A spokesman for Amazon lists the machines in several places, such as shopping malls, airports as well as events. “We are very pleased with the response from the public so far, and can thus provide a new easy option to buy. Ereaders and tablets,”
